What is a Chicago-Latrobe #20 left-hand jobber drill bit used for?
A Chicago-Latrobe #20 left-hand jobber drill bit is used for drilling holes in metal, particularly for screw extraction or applications where reverse rotation prevents bit walking. It suits maintenance, toolmaking, and production environments requiring precise 0.1610-inch holes.
What are the specifications of the Chicago-Latrobe 44490 drill bit?
The Chicago-Latrobe 44490 is a #20 jobber length drill bit with a 0.1610-inch diameter, 118° point angle, and high-speed steel construction. It features a left-hand spiral for reverse-rotation drilling. This MPN 44490 bit is designed for general-purpose metal drilling.

How to select the correct left-hand drill bit for screw extraction?
To select a left-hand drill bit for screw extraction, match the bit diameter to the screw's minor thread diameter. A Chicago-Latrobe #20 (0.1610 inch) bit works for small fasteners. Use a slow speed with steady pressure to avoid breakage. Always wear safety glasses.
